VPN tools use tunneling protocols to encrypt data so it can be safely transmitted and received across less secure remote networks. An enterprise mobile VPN establishes secure connections between users' mobile devices and corporate resources and services exclusive to the intranet. The Defense Information Systems Agency maintains the DOD Information Network (DODIN) Approved Products List (APL) process, as outlined in DOD Instruction 8100.04 on behalf of the Department of Defense. Testing is conducted by approved commercial testing labs that are accredited by both the National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) and the NIAP.
